Route Decision Behaviour in a Commuting Scenario: Simple Heuristics Adaptation and Effect of Traffic Forecast
Klügl, Franziska; Bazzan, Ana L. C. - In: Journal of Artificial Societies and Social Simulation 7 (2004) 1, pp. 1-1
One challenge to researchers dealing with traffic management is to find efficient ways to model and predict traffic flow. Due to the social nature of traffic, most of the decisions are not independent. Thus, in traffic systems the inter-dependence of actions leads to a high frequency of implicit...
